Alternative Investment Advisor Firm Raises Japan Game

The organisation marks its 20th anniversary this year.

Sussex Partners, a global investment advisory firm that specialises in hedge funds and alternative investment asset classes, has appointed Kanji Kikuchi as a partner to support the firm’s outreach in the Japanese market. 

Kikuchi is joining from Credit Suisse Securities in Tokyo where he was head of fund solutions for the firm’s private banking clients. Prior to Credit Suisse, Kikuchi worked in alternative investment sales and structured solutions at Merrill Lynch, BNP Paribas and, earlier, at Mizuho Securities in Tokyo. He brings close to 30 years’ experience of the Japan investments market. 

Sussex Partners has been engaged with Japan since the firm’s inception in 2003.

"Tokyo is home to so many sophisticated and forward-looking investing institutions. Kikuchi brings a wealth of local market experience and relationships to Sussex Partners, and we welcome the opportunity through him to extend and deepen our engagement with Japanese investors,” Patrick Ghali, managing partner of Sussex Partners, said.

The business, which advises institutional investors including pension funds, private banks, family offices and wealth managers, will celebrate its 20th anniversary this year.
